How Our Attic Water Extraction Process Works

When you call us for attic water extraction, our team springs into action. We’ll start by assessing the damage and creating a customized plan to get your attic dry and safe. Our technicians will use specialized equipment to extract water, dry the space, and apply antimicrobial treatments to prevent mold growth. Our goal is to get your attic back to normal as quickly as possible, with minimal disruption to your life.

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

Our technician will arrive at your home, assess the damage, and create a customized plan to extract water and dry the space. This may involve inspecting the attic, roof, and surrounding areas to identify the source of the water damage and develop a plan to address it. We’ll also provide you with a detailed estimate of the work that needs to be done.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Next, our technician will use specialized equipment to extract water from the attic. This may involve using pumps, vacuums, or other equipment to remove standing water and water-soaked materials. Our goal is to remove as much water as possible to prevent further damage and mold growth.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

After the water has been extracted, our technician will use specialized equipment to dry the space and reduce humidity levels. This may involve using dehumidifiers, fans, or other equipment to speed up the drying process. Our goal is to get your attic dry and safe as quickly as possible.

Step 4: Antimicrobial Treatment

Once the space is dry, our technician will apply antimicrobial treatments to prevent mold growth. This may involve using products that inhibit mold growth or applying a mold-killing solution. Our goal is to prevent mold growth and keep your attic safe and healthy.

Attic Water Extraction v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ak in the roof, easy to access Yes No DIY may be enough for small, easy-to-reach leaks.
Large flood in the attic, multiple areas affected No Yes A professional team will be needed to handle large-scale water damage and prevent further damage.
Structural damage to the roof or attic No Yes Structural dam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to repair safely and effectively.
Hidden moisture behind walls or ceilings No Yes Hidden moisture needs specialized equipment and expertise to detect and address.

With attic water extraction, DIY may not be the best option. A professional team will be needed to handle large-scale water damage, hidden moisture, and structural damage.

How can I prevent water damage in my attic?

To prevent water damage in your attic, make sure to inspect your roof and attic regularly for signs of wear and tear. Check for missing or damaged shingles, sagging roof lines, and signs of water damage.
